Common PCOS Symptoms

  • Irregular Menstrual Patterns: PCOS symptoms in females commonly include missing periods and extended periods and sometimes complete absence of menstruation.
  • Excess Hormones: Women with PCOS in Dubai experience high androgen levels which produce acne and excessive facial and body hair growth along with hair thinning on their scalp.
  • Obesity and Resistance to Insulin: Due to PCOS women frequently develop central obesity and experience challenges with weight loss because their bodies resist insulin effectively.
  • Pregnancy Challenges: PCOS in women commonly lead to disrupted ovulation and they face challenges regarding getting pregnant and create a barrier in family planning.

Amongst other symptoms mood swings alongside skin darkening known as acanthosis nigricans and pelvic pain are common with PCOS.

Diagnosis and First Steps

The diagnostic process starts by evaluating PCOS symptoms along with tracking menstrual patterns and conducting hormone blood tests and ovarian cyst detection through ultrasound.

Management Options Available in Dubai & Sharjah

Lifestyle modifications

The primary therapeutic approach for treating PCOS symptoms in Sharjah and Dubai focuses on weight management through dietary changes and physical activity. Small weight reductions between 5 to 10 percent produce major improvements in both symptom control and insulin resistance management.
The treatment of PCOS requires patients to follow complete food-based low glycemic anti-inflammatory diets while performing routine physical activities.

Medications

Menstrual cycle regulation and reduced acne and hair growth in women not pursuing pregnancy can be achieved through hormonal contraceptives (pills, IUDs, patches).
Insulin sensitizers which include metformin function to improve insulin resistance and enable ovulation restoration primarily in obese women displaying PCOS symptoms.
Among other treatment options for PCOS to navigate fertility issues, includes ovulation-inducing agents like clomiphene & letrozole together with assisted reproductive techniques such as IVF.
Anti-androgens which include spironolactone and finasteride and eflornithine help minimize hair growth and acne symptoms when they appear prominently.

Surgical Approach

Laparoscopic ovarian drilling serves as a treatment option after medication failure to induce ovulation, but its usage has decreased because of contemporary medical developments.

Alternative & Supportive Therapies

The available alternative treatments in Dubai consist of acupuncture together with herbal treatments including spearmint, which could assist hormonal stability and stress reduction but scientific evidence remains minimal. Commonly Asked Questions

1. What are the first signs of PCOS symptoms in females?
The initial indicators of PCOS in females include irregular menstrual periods and continuous acne, along with unexplainable weight increase and excessive hair development, which often appear together with mood shifts and tiredness.

2. Can weight loss alone manage PCOS symptoms?
A body weight decrease between five and ten percent will assist both cycle regulation and insulin resistance improvement yet additional treatments will produce better outcomes.

3. What options exist for women in Sharjah who want to conceive?
Fertility treatments in Sharjah include lifestyle adjustments and ovulation-inducing medications together with in-vitro fertilization procedures. Women should consult a PCOS specialist in Dubai or Sharjah for individualized treatment plans.

4. Are there non-drug options to manage PCOS symptoms?
The management of PCOS symptoms can benefit from dietary changes along with physical activity and stress control and acupuncture and herbal remedies but these approaches should always support medical treatment rather than serve as its substitute.

5. Will my acne or hair growth resolve with treatment?
Treatment through hormonal contraceptives along with anti-androgens typically leads to substantial acne and hirsutism reduction but laser hair removal provides permanent cosmetic benefits.

6. Can PCOS cause long-term health issues if untreated?
PCOS remains untreated and leads to elevated chances of developing type 2 diabetes together with metabolic syndrome and cardiovascular complications and mood disorders.
